So I am trying to write a maven plugin that would have a repo2runnable
functionality. And it does not work ;-). 

The code is available here: http://www.fpaste.org/9176/

To cut the long code short - I use the eclipse runner tycho bundle as a
base, add following dependencies:
org.eclipse.equinox.p2.repository.tools
org.eclipse.equinox.ds
org.eclipse.equinox.p2.touchpoint.eclipse
org.eclipse.equinox.p2.touchpoint.natives

and then run Eclipse with following arguments

addProgramArgs(true, cli, 
 "-install", runtime.getLocation().getAbsolutePath(), 
 "-configuration", new File(work,"configuration").getAbsolutePath(),
 "-data", new File(work,"data").getAbsolutePath());
 
 String appArgLine = "-application
org.eclipse.equinox.p2.repository.repo2runnable -source " + sourceRepo +
" -destination " + targetLocation;

The output runnable folder looks quite nice
-rw-rw-r--.  artifacts.jar
drwxrwxr-x.  binary
-rw-rw-r--.  content.jar

except the plugins and features folder are missing, despite content.xml
has valid content (artifacts.xml contains only *_root unit).

Running the same command with eclipse.exe succeeds (the repo is properly
generated).

What may be wrong? How to investigate this?
